Queen Elizabeth protects herself from the heat with a fan. And hot tea

C.How will Queen Elizabeth protect herself from the 43 degrees expected in the south of England these days? The sovereign remains in her apartments in Windsor, whose thousand rooms have always been described as rather cold and difficult to heat. But a collaborator of hers immediately installed an old fan that runs from her bedroom to the monarch’s favorite living room.

Queen Elizabeth: hot tea even in summer

While waiting to move to cooler Balmoral, Scotland for her summer vacation, the doctors recommended that she drink plenty of water and avoid taking walks in Windsor Gardens. However, Elizabeth prefers hot tea even in the heat of summer. And she doesn’t detach herself from an old heater which, like the fan, often follows her from room to room.

Bottles of water for the royal guards

The queen couldn’t help but worry about the guards stationed for hours outside the gates of Windsor and Buckingham Palace, tight in their iconic red uniform and with a very warm bear fur cap. And in a completely extraordinary way, it allowed them to sip water every now and then, without moving from their position and continuing to hold their rifle.
